BaoSteel delaying 60 million tonne capacity target for 3 years

Mr He Wenbo GM of BaoSteel expressed that their crude steel production in 2012 amounted to 44 million tonnes and they have shut down 3 million tonnes of capacity at the end of last year in Shanghai base.

 

Besides, they decided to control steel capacity in Shanghai within 16 million tonnes via closing down 3 million more capacity. And after acquisition, the capacity in Shanghai would decrease 10-15 million tonnes.

 

More importantly, their 60 million tonnes capacity target was delayed to 3 years after 2015, previous time limit, as their first priority is to improve technical capability and mainly producing high value-added steel plates, etc.
